Since 1976, PIU has been preparing men and women to serve Jesus Christ in Micronesia and throughout the world. The vision of PIU is to be a leader throughout Guam, Micronesia and the Pacific Region in providing accessible, transformational and quality Christian higher education that will prepare men and women with a biblical worldview for leadership and service in life, work, and ministry in the global community and the church.
PIU brings together students from many different countries and many religious denominations, so that no matter which “island” you come from, you can experience the many cultures of the world in a small-school environment where students, staff and faculty know each other and can develop close relationships.
The PIU program provides a well-rounded, nationally accredited Christian education within these three colleges:
* PIBC– Pacific Islands Bible College provides certificate, diploma, AA and BA programs in Bible with minors in ministry and education to prepare students for pastoral, teaching, missions and other ministries in the church and global community. PIBC is a school where you can learn to do cross-cultural ministry by doing it under the leadership of caring and experienced staff and faculty
* PICC — Pacific Islands Christian College provides Bachelor and Associate of Arts degrees in liberal studies, a Certificate in Scuba Diving Instruction and a Certificate in English program that prepares students for college level English. In the future PICC plans to offer an elementary education program to meet the great need for well-prepared teachers in Micronesia.
* PIES — Pacific Islands Evangelical Seminary offers a Master of Arts in Religion designed to produce theologically trained leaders for the churches of the Pacific and to develop effective missionaries to the unreached peoples of Southeast Asia.
